

Maureen M. Ruscitti (nee O’Connell), age 77. A resident of Downers Grove, IL, the memorial mass service celebrating her life will be held on Saturday, March 8, 2014 at 11:00 am at St. Joseph’s Catholic Church, 4801 Main St., Downers Grove, IL 60515. Interment private burial of ashes will take place at All Saints Catholic Cemetery, 700 N. River Road, Des Plaines, IL 60016.
A consummate mother, caregiver and homemaker, Maureen was known for her cooking, and enjoyed preparing meals for her family and lots of pot-lucks with friends. She loved her family dearly, and was a vital part of their daily lives. She resided with her daughter, Mary K. Kennedy (Ruscitti), Mary’s husband, Arthur (Artie) Kennedy, and their two daughters, Maura her “Beauty Baby”, and Maegan her “Baby Love”. Maureen enjoyed spending most of her free time with her grandchildren. She also enjoyed reading books, the daily Chicago Tribune cover to cover and doing crosswords in pen daily. Maureen attended Notre Dame Catholic High School for Girls, graduating in 1954 and Wilbur Wright College, in Chicago, IL. Many of her longtime friends she met at Notre Dame ad consider her their “most fun friend”. She was a Ms. Progress contestant in her late teens. Prior to her retirement, Maureen was employed as a secretary for construction company and then as a paralegal secretary for 30 plus years, with many law offices in Cook and DuPage County, including her boss and best friend, the late Leo McLennon in his Park Ridge office. She was the best “gal Friday” anyone ever had, and took to law like a fish to water. Prior to office secretaries being called paralegals, she helped set the bar for the rest to come. She loved to dance the jitterbug and was once crowned Jitterbug King and Queen with her former husband. She then was a mom for many years and returned to law after 16 years. She was the ultimate caregiver, caring for her family, her ailing mother, and aunt daily, and eventually a caregiver for Resurrection Retirement Home for many residents for about 10 years, giving those residents a well-cared for and loving end, including the late Margaret Senior, who became like family to Maureen’s own. Continuing that path she cared daily for her two grandchildren and never wanted anyone but family to do so. She was lover of the arts, including opera and had season tickets to the Lyric Opera for many years. A staunch Republican, she supported the National Right to Life Organization, wrote or called her legislatures often and walked door-to-door as a Goldwater girl.
Mrs. Ruscitti passed away Sunday, February 16, 2014 at Good Samaritan Hospital in Downers Grove. Born Maureen M. O’Connell on December 7, 1936 in Chicago, IL and was the middle daughter five children to the late Charles T. and the late Katherine C. (Rork) O’Connell. She was predeceased by her beloved son Michael C. Ruscitti. She was also predeceased by her former husband of 16 years, Ray S. Ruscitti and her two brothers Timothy (Nadine and son Tim) and William O’Connell. Maureen is survived by her daughter Mary (Artie) Kennedy. She is also survived by her two grandchildren, Maura and Maegan Kennedy, her sister, Katherine J. (O’Connell) Santoro and brother, Dennis F. (Sue) O’Connell. Maureen was the beloved aunt to twelve nieces and nephews, as well as great-aunt to many. She is surely jitterbugging in heaven today.
